The Growing Role of Education Consultants
Choosing the right school, planning a college application strategy, or supporting a student with unique learning needs can be a complex and high-stakes process. In Dallas, a thriving community of education consultants has emerged to help families navigate these decisions with clarity and confidence. These professionals bring specialized knowledge of local and national education systems, admissions requirements, and student development.
Unlike tutors who focus on academic content, education consultants take a broader, strategic view. They guide families through school selection, application timelines, essay development, financial aid, and long-term academic planning. As competition for top schools and universities intensifies, their expertise has become increasingly valuable across the Dallas metroplex.

Trends in Educational Consulting
The field of educational consulting is evolving to meet changing family needs and shifting admissions landscapes. Test-optional policies at many universities have increased the importance of a well-rounded application, prompting consultants to focus more on extracurricular development, personal narrative, and authentic student voice.
Technology has also expanded access to consulting services, with many advisors now offering virtual meetings that connect Dallas families with expertise regardless of geography. Additionally, there is growing demand for consultants who specialize in supporting students with learning differences, gifted programs, and specialized talents in areas such as the arts and athletics.

When to Begin Working With a Consultant
Timing can significantly influence the effectiveness of educational consulting. While many families first seek help during the junior or senior year of high school, engaging a consultant earlier often yields better results. Starting in the freshman or sophomore year allows time to build a thoughtful course schedule, explore meaningful extracurricular activities, and develop the personal strengths that admissions committees value. For private school placement, families may benefit from beginning the process a full year before the intended enrollment date. Early planning reduces last-minute stress, creates room for course corrections, and gives students the space to grow into well-rounded applicants rather than scrambling to assemble a competitive profile at the eleventh hour.
